"Shadowed Love" by shadowwv

Shadow tones, shadow notes
Shadow runes, shadow motes
Shadow rhyme and shadow reason
As we cavort in shadow's season.
Shadow days, shadow nights
Shadow wrongs, shadow rights
Shadow justice and shadow truths
As we roam the shadows uncouth.
Shadow ways, shadow means
Shadow senses, shadow scenes
Shadows below and shadows above
Nothing dispels shadowed love.
25 January 2002 shadowwv
